WebbStandard drinks A standard drink is used to show how much alcohol is in a drink regardless of the percentage. In Aotearoa, a standard drink contains 10 grams of pure alcohol. Every can, bottle, or cask of alcohol must have a label that tells us how many standard drinks are inside them. Once you know what a standard drink is you will know how much alcohol you are actually drinking. One Standard Drink Equals: 341 ml (12 oz) bottle of 5% alcohol beer, cider or cooler. 43 ml (1.5 oz) shot of 40% hard liquor (vodka, rum, whisky, gin etc.)
